Current Armenia deposit‑rate environment (2024–2025): why rates are high — headline stats and recent levels

Armenia's deposit market has been rewarding savers. The average deposit interest rate stood around 8.15% in 2024, per World Bank data via TradingEconomics, indicating elevated returns on bank savings compared with many markets.

Against this backdrop, the Central Bank of Armenia's deposit facility rate was approximately 5.25% as of September 2025—below the retail rates quoted by many banks, a gap that helps explain why headline retail deposit offers remain attractive.

Top Armenian dram (AMD) term deposit offers: current leaders

Headline AMD yields remain in double digits on longer terms. Current tables show:

  • Top offers around 10.5% p.a., with ACBA and Armeconombank among the leaders on longer tenors.
  • A broader pack near 10.25% p.a., including Araratbank and Evocabank for approximately 18–24 month placements.

These levels align with Armenia's high average deposit interest regime and underscore the yield premium available for AMD savers.

Top USD/EUR deposit yields in Armenia: dollar/euro leaders and how they compare to AMD offers

USD leaders: current top offers are around 4.5%–4.75% p.a., with Evocabank, Artsakhbank, and Armeconombank frequently among the top entries on aggregator tables.

Comparison to AMD: AMD headline rates near 10.25%–10.5% p.a. significantly outpace USD yields, reflecting the currency and liquidity premium typical in Armenia's market.

Term structure and tenor trade‑offs: how rates rise with longer terms and the best‑paying tenors

In Armenia, the term premium is clear: banks pay meaningfully more to hold funds longer. One publicly posted schedule shows AMD rates around 4.75% for 45–90 days, rising to roughly 9.5% for 546–730 days—illustrating the payoff for committing to longer tenors.

Aggregator tables also indicate the highest headline AMD rates are commonly found at 12–24 months. For investors balancing liquidity and return, this is typically the sweet spot to compare across banks.
